POST-FINASTERIDE SYNDROME AND THE IMPACT OF 5-ALPHA REDUCTASE INHIBITORS ON NEUROENDOCRINE AND METABOLIC AXES
Abstract
Objective: To analyze recent scientific evidence on the neuroendocrine and metabolic impacts associated with the chronic use of 5-alpha reductase inhibitors, with an emphasis on the pathophysiology of Post-Finasteride Syndrome. Methodology: An integrative literature review was conducted in the PubMed/MEDLINE and LILACS/VHL databases, selecting nine high-impact studies published between 2021 and 2026. The PICO strategy guided the analysis of clinical outcomes and molecular mechanisms. Results: Pharmacovigilance data consolidate PFS as a high-intensity multisystem entity, characterized by refractory sexual dysfunction, severe depression, and suicidal ideation, especially in young men. Enzymatic inhibition, particularly in the central nervous system, suppresses the synthesis of active metabolites such as allopregnanolone, resulting in GABAergic dysregulation and excitotoxicity. In the metabolic axis, the suppression of dihydrotestosterone is associated with insulin resistance, non-alcoholic fatty liver disease,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us, and alterations in the gut microbiota. Polymorphisms in the SRD5A2 gene and epigenetic alterations, such as androgen receptor DNA methylation, were identified as sustaining the chronicity and potential irreversibility of symptoms. Conclusion: PFS transcends transient side effects, requiring a transition to personalized medicine models with pre-treatment genomic screening and rigorous informed consent protocols to mitigate permanent biopsychosocial risks.
